Cardi B and Kehlani Team Up for Emotional Single “Safe”

When “Safe” dropped on September 19, 2025, it marked one of the most affecting moments on Am I the Drama?, Cardi B’s second studio album. Teaming up once more, Cardi B and Kehlani trade raw emotion, storytelling, and contrast — Cardi bringing her candid intensity, Kehlani her smooth strength.

The tension in “Safe” lies in the collision of hope and fear. The lyrics lean into what many relationships try to promise but don’t always deliver: security. Kehlani’s voice carries in moments of longing for the kind of emotional space where one can breathe. Cardi B’s verses expose doubt, conflict, and the stakes of vulnerability — especially when the stakes include a pregnancy and trust being broken.

The video amplifies the message. It opens in warmth and promise: family, closeness, safety. Then things change. Cardi B, pregnant in the narrative, grapples with a partner who grows distant. Secrets emerge. Pain becomes visible. The tension escalates until a shocking ending redefines what “safe” truly means.

“Safe” isn’t just another hit—it’s one of the tracks on the album getting a strong listener response. It replaced another single at No. 1 on Apple Music US shortly after release.

In a career built on boldness, Cardi B appears to be shifting now toward introspection. With “Safe,” she and Kehlani show that strength doesn’t always roar—it sometimes trembles, it sometimes cries, it sometimes simply wants to feel protected.
